Touring cycling routes in Walmer Forest Reserve traverse a landscape characterized by Box-Ironbark forest and undulating terrain. The area features remnants of historic gold mining activity, adding a unique historical context to the rides. Located near Castlemaine, the reserve offers a mix of mostly paved surfaces suitable for various skill levels. These routes provide an Australian bush experience with diverse natural features.

Castlemaine Station provides regular commuter service on the V/Line as well as the historic Victorian Goldfields Railway. This makes it a great option for history buffs and cyclists and hikers who want to do a long one-way journey and take the train the other way.

The Mill Castlemaine was a woollen mill built in 1875 and is now a hub for artisan produce and culture. The vintage precinct, home to the Vintage Bazaar and Platform No. 5, is home to an incredibly eclectic mix of vintage, re-purposed and second-hand goods and is guaranteed to be one of the best vintage shopping experiences you've ever had. The excellent Shedshaker Brewery Taproom offers a large range of year round and seasonal beers and is a very welcome find after riding the rail trail from Maldon. Look out for the Scotch Ale....

A historic train station with beautiful old trains and carriages situated about the site. The goldfields steam train to Castlemaine arrives/departs from here and it also marks the start of the fantastic Castlemaine-Maldon rail trail.

What amenities are available at Walmer Forest Reserve for cyclists?

The upgraded Walmer State Forest Recreation Area serves as a welcoming hub with modern amenities. You'll find all-abilities toilets, gas and wood fire BBQ facilities, and picnic spots under old-growth pine trees. Interpretive signage by the Djaara First Nations People also offers insights into the local culture.

Are there any longer touring cycling routes that connect to nearby towns?

Yes, there are routes that extend beyond the immediate reserve, connecting to nearby towns and points of interest. For instance, the Castlemaine Station – Maldon Railway Station loop from Castlemaine is a 21.6-mile (34.7 km) trail that leads through historical gold mining areas, offering a longer exploration of the region.
